Software Developer - C++/C# (Shebrooke)
Software Developer - C++/C# (Shebrooke)

Job Details

Genetec Published: September 26, 2017
Location
Job Type

Description

Genetec is a Canadian company that has established itself as a leader in the development of IP security solutions. Global provider of IP video surveillance, access control and license plate recognition solutions, Genetec employs over 900 employees across six continents.

Due to strong growth, Genetec is currently looking for software developers to build a team in its new office in Sherbrooke. If you like challenges, varied tasks, and that the idea to start a new project stimulates you, apply now to join our team!

The Software Developer - C++/C# contributes to the development of new features to support everything that relates to video processing and related metadata, and the integration of various external systems.

Responsibilities:

•Design and implement object-oriented applications developed in C++ and C# using .NET 4.5, the Windows platform and Microsoft Visual Studio;
•Work on the Frontend and Backend components of the product using all major technologies of the .NET Framework;
•Create and perform maintenance of major architectures;
•Participate, as part of an Agile development process, in the design, the tasks planning, the development of features and their delivery to the quality assurance team.
•Manage their time to respect milestones and delivery dates;
•Work in conjunction with our partners and software testers to fix different bugs in the product.

Requirements:

•Junior – Minimum of 1 year of experience in C++ or C#;
•Intermediate and senior – We are also looking for intermediate and senior;
•Motivated to work in a fast-paced environment and enjoys the challenge of unfamiliar tasks;
•Able to work in teams and collaborate.

Technical Requirements:

•Excellent knowledge of object-oriented programming;
•Thorough knowledge of the .NET Framework and STL Library C++14;
•Experience with multi-threaded programming;
•Experience with Visual Studio 2015 and basic concepts of software development (version management, code analysis, unit testing);
•Knowledge of networking (TCP/IP, UDP).

Assets:

•Experience in functionnal programming: Erlang/OTP, Elixir, OCaml, F#, Haskell or scheme/lisp;
•Experience with WPF 3.0 ou 4.0;
•Video streaming and decoding: HTTP, RTP, RTSP, MJPEG, MPEG-4, H.264;
•Experience with distributed architectures, asynchronous paradigms and/or parallel computing;
•Experience with network IPC frameworks and subsystems like WCF and Window Sockets.

Why working at Genetec?

•Attractive compensation package – competitive salary, year-end bonus plan and an attractive employee referral program;
•Individual career path – management and technical career growth, regular performance assessment, teams of world-wide IT professionals;
•Work-life balance – 3 week vacation with extra days during the winter holidays, flexible family-friendly hours, team building and company events;
•Stimulating challenges – software development to design new features of a world-class system and creation of a new team.

Recruiting Disclaimer

The material contained herein is provided for informational purposes only. All open jobs offered by Genetec on this recruitment system are subject to specific job skill requirements. The job skill requirements, qualifications, and preferred experience are determined by a group within the company that is offering the position, and all positions are subject to local prevailing employment laws and restrictions. This would include immigration laws pertaining to work authorization requirements and any other applicable government permissions or compliance. The materials on this site are provided without warranties of any kind, either expressed or implied, including but not limited to warranties regarding the accuracy or completeness of the information contained on this site or in any referenced links. While Genetec attempts to update this site on a timely basis, the information is effective only as of the time and date of posting. Genetec reserves the right to transfer applicants' details to our recruitment partners. Strict confidentiality will be observed at all times. Genetec is an equal opportunity employer. The information on this site is for information purposes only and is not intended to be relied upon with legal consequence.

Related Jobs

Accountant (bilingual)   Sherbrooke
October 12, 2017
October 12, 2017
October 12, 2017
October 12, 2017

Supporting Partners